25 Long Sentences: Subject + Predicate
Rule: Subject = Who/What the sentence is about
Predicate = What the subject does, is, or feels

1. The brave soldier who fought in the war received a medal for his courage and dedication.
2. My younger brother and my sister play football in the ground every evening after school.
3. The tall building near the railway station was constructed by skilled workers over a period of three years.
4. Students who study hard and work honestly always achieve success in their exams and in life.
5. The old man with a long white beard walks slowly through the park every morning at sunrise.
6. Heavy rain and strong wind damaged many houses and uprooted big trees in the village last night.
7. The beautiful painting made by a famous artist was sold at a very high price in the international auction.
8. My mother who cooks delicious food for everyone woke up early in the morning to prepare breakfast for the whole family.
9. Children playing cricket on the road stopped their game immediately when they saw a car coming towards them.
10. The teacher who teaches us English grammar explains every topic with examples so that all students can understand easily.
11. Honesty and hard work are the two most important qualities that lead a person towards success and respect.
12. The book lying on the wooden table in my room contains many interesting stories that teach us good moral values.
13. Birds flying high in the blue sky sing sweet songs and make the morning environment fresh and peaceful.
14. The river flowing through our city provides water for drinking, farming, and other daily needs of the people.
15. My best friend who lives in Delhi called me yesterday to invite me for his birthday party next month.
16. Scientists working in the research laboratory are trying to find a new medicine for dangerous diseases like cancer.
17. The big mango tree in front of my house gives sweet fruits to all children during the summer season every year.
18. People who help others without expecting anything are loved and respected by everyone in the society and community.
19. The airplane flying above the clouds at high speed carries hundreds of passengers safely to different countries across the world.
20. My grandfather who tells interesting stories sits on the chair in the garden and shares his life experiences with all of us.
21. Swimming in cold water during winter season improves blood circulation and keeps our body healthy and strong for many years.
22. The team of doctors at the city hospital worked day and night to save the lives of patients affected by the virus.
23. To speak the truth in every situation is a great virtue that makes a person honest and trustworthy in society.
24. The students of class ten who appeared for the board exam waited anxiously for their results with hopes of getting good marks and ranks.
25. The sun that rises in the east every morning gives us light, heat, and energy which are essential for all living things on earth.
